Bobby Wade - Early Years

Early Years

Wade attended Desert Vista High School in Phoenix, Arizona and was a student letterwinner in football, track & field, soccer and basketball. As a senior, he was the USA Today High School Football Player of the Year and he helped lead his team to the Class 5A State Championship. In track & field, he won the Class 5A triple jump title as a senior.
